1874 Shield Nickel in Copper
Judd-1350, PR64 Brown

1874 5C Shield Nickel, Judd-1350, Pollock-1494, R.7, PR64 Brown PCGS. Ex: Simpson. The regular Shield nickel dies for the year. Struck in copper with a plain edge. Two or three examples are known in this metal, plus the same number in aluminum. Although often described as dies trials, they were manufactured for sale to a small group of well-connected insiders. This coin does not appear to match the example offered by Stack's in October 1997. It does match the 1979 Oscar J. Pearl coin with a diagnostic spot on the reverse denticles at 7:30. Copper-brown surfaces display considerable violet and maroon accents. Glossy and attractive.
Ex: Oscar J. Pearl Collection (Bowers and Ruddy, 6/1979), lot 1373; November Signature (Heritage, 11/2020), lot 3238; Long Beach Signature (Heritage, 6/2021), lot 3765.
